你查询的IP:[124.220.78.175]  地理位置:中国–上海–上海

最新查询59.191.57.1 124.68.48.91 120.64.177.129 116.204.182.76 123.100.8.188 203.89.117.111 119.78.40.55 211.80.255.6 116.252.164.41 119.162.102.245 124.220.78.175 218.185.192.155 125.213.244.38 119.18.224.196 202.131.48.102 221.224.127.75 203.175.128.50 123.4.51.116 203.222.192.253 202.69.16.56 114.54.197.123 203.158.16.100 118.84.49.17 61.4.80.28 116.255.128.149 203.207.128.107 202.112.78.184 203.192.55.179 121.56.254.47 202.142.16.12 161.207.236.22 123.232.209.94